Transaction 982dd35f6e23f449c4f8ddf2b98f873705cbf9e016fcef6adfa1c2ddfda3808b

block
316d86426999a9723f341b54c131df9b1945b4042754ab0f02b17132bc52fe27

1 Input

25 Outputs